A Canadian research institute has developed a steady-state water-to-air heat pump modeling program, SIMPAC, featuring non-azeotropic refrigerant mixture simulation. The Camahan-Starling-Desantis (CSD) equation of state is used in SIMPAC, which is a follow-on development of the HPBI program published by Domanski (1986). This model has been successfully validated for pure refrigerant R22 and mixtures R13B1/R152a and R22/R114. It was then used to predict R22/R23 behavior. This paper provides an overview of the model and its validation.
